should i have to call in sick every single day when i'm signed off work? (england) by georgiaisgucci in LegalAdviceUK

[–]Royal_Promotion 105 points106 points  (0 children)

NO! You should just provide the GP Fit Note (NHS GP presumably) to your manager or a member of the business staff with HR responsibilities, along with a short explanation by way of a 'covering letter'. Which in effect could be an email or phone call. That's it. You'll need to talk to them about a phased return to work after your surgery. What does your contract say about absence for illness? Don't engage with demands for weekly, let alone daily phone calls with the business.

Visiting Penzance by Trick-Bet-8018 in Cornwall

[–]Royal_Promotion 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Visiting in May - things are starting to get busy. Jubilee Pool in the thermal section (need to book). Fisherman's Arms Newlyn for meals and the view. Mackerel Sky, for awesome seafood, at Newlyn Bridge will be open by then. Trengwainton Gardens, St Michael's Mount and Godolphin House are the closest NT properties. Look at events at the newly reopened Ritz in PZ itself. The Lugger may have karaoke evenings, also possibly the Pirate Inn, The Globe and Ale House, Seven Stars and Star Inn.
